首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

单击按钮时播放声音的最有效方法

是使用HTML5的Audio元素。该元素允许在网页中嵌入音频文件,并通过JavaScript控制其播放和暂停。

具体步骤如下:

  1. 准备音频文件:将所需的音频文件准备好,可以是MP3、WAV、OGG等格式。
  2. 创建HTML按钮:使用HTML标签创建一个按钮,例如:<button id="playButton">播放声音</button>
  3. 添加JavaScript代码:在页面中添加以下JavaScript代码,用于控制音频的播放和暂停:// 获取按钮元素 var playButton = document.getElementById('playButton'); // 创建音频对象 var audio = new Audio('path/to/audio/file.mp3'); // 绑定按钮点击事件 playButton.addEventListener('click', function() { // 播放音频 audio.play(); });

在上述代码中,需要将'path/to/audio/file.mp3'替换为实际音频文件的路径。

  1. 完善功能:根据需求,可以添加其他功能,例如停止按钮、音量控制等。可以通过调用audio.pause()方法来暂停音频的播放。

这种方法的优势是简单易用,适用于大多数现代浏览器。它可以在用户单击按钮时立即播放声音,无需等待额外的网络请求。此外,HTML5的Audio元素还提供了其他功能,如音量控制、播放进度等。

在腾讯云的产品中,可以使用腾讯云对象存储(COS)来存储音频文件,并通过腾讯云的云函数(SCF)来实现音频的播放控制。具体产品介绍和链接如下:

  • 腾讯云对象存储(COS):提供高可靠、低成本的云端存储服务,适用于存储各种类型的文件,包括音频文件。详细介绍请参考:腾讯云对象存储(COS)
  • 腾讯云云函数(SCF):无服务器计算服务,可以用于编写和运行音频播放控制的后端逻辑。详细介绍请参考:腾讯云云函数(SCF)

请注意,以上只是腾讯云的一些产品示例,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券